Sucuri, a GoDaddy company since the 2017 acquisition, provides a complete website security package, featuring web application firewall (WAF), DDoS protection, as well as website malware detection and management.

Vioro is a website security and observability platform engineered for digital agencies, freelance developers, and IT professionals managing multiple client websites. The platform consolidates uptime monitoring, vulnerability scanning, and configuration audits into a single, centralized command center, allowing technical teams to monitor entire portfolios simultaneously.
